A group of 16 year olds, belonging to Team 5 of National Citizen Service (NCS), have been tasked to help their community. They have decided to focus on families and children, specifically raising money for the charity, Hope Support Services.

This Ross-based charity helps youngsters who have a family member who has been diagnosed with a serious illness.On Wednesday, August 22nd, at Bartestree Village Hall, Hereford, the team is hosting a charitable event between 11am and 3pm. Entry is free, although prices may vary on different activities, such as the tombola, bouncy castle, nail and face painting, bake sale, and much more.

While all families are welcome, the team want to especially invite foster families and disadvantaged families.

Team 5 members are hoping that as many families as possible will attend, and are excited that the day will, in turn, help families involved with Hope.
